An owner-operator running 2,500 miles a week with 18 percent deadhead is parked while paid miles wait somewhere else. Cut that to 8 percent and the same truck runs 250 more loaded miles a week. At a $2.10 average rate, that’s $525 in additional weekly revenue without driving more hours, sleeping less, or upgrading equipment. The cut comes from one habit: booking the reload before the current load delivers, not after. Plan the week, not the day.

The American Transportation Research Institute’s 2025 Operational Costs of Trucking report puts deadhead at roughly 16 percent of total miles for the broader fleet. New owner-operators on the spot market typically run higher, between 18 and 22 percent. The operators sitting at 8 to 10 percent did not get there by luck. They got there by rebuilding how they book.

Why daily reactive booking creates deadhead

The default for newer operators is daily booking. Pick up Monday. Deliver Tuesday. Spend Tuesday afternoon and Wednesday morning hunting for the next load on the load board. Take what’s there. Most weeks, what’s there isn’t going where the truck should go next.

Daily booking optimizes for “the next load.” Weekly booking optimizes for “the next four loads.” Those are different problems with different math.

The daily approach loses money in three places. The truck sits between deliver and pickup, sometimes 12 to 24 hours, while the operator works the load board. The available freight at delivery time is whatever didn’t get booked earlier in the day, which means it pays less. The reposition leg is usually deadhead, because the load board option in the destination city was either gone or worse than driving 100 miles to a market with more freight.

The weekly approach trades short-term flexibility for routing efficiency. The next three loads are booked before the current one delivers, the lanes connect, and the gap between delivery and pickup shrinks from 18 hours to 4. The blended rate per mile is higher, the deadhead is lower, and the operator drives less to make more.

The weekly planning system

The system has four pieces. None of them are complicated. All of them are uncomfortable to set up the first time and easy to run after.

First piece: a primary lane and two backup lanes. The operator picks one regional or one-way lane that runs reliably (Memphis to Atlanta, Chicago to Indianapolis, Dallas to Houston). That’s the spine. Two backup lanes cover the case where the primary lane has no freight that week. Most established operators run a known set of three to five lanes. New operators rarely commit to fewer than ten, which is why their books are noisy.

Second piece: reload booked before delivery. The rule is simple. By the time the truck rolls into the receiver, the next load is booked. Not “looking.” Not “calling around.” Booked. This single discipline collapses 6 to 12 hours of deadhead per week into nothing. The reload doesn’t have to pay top of market. It has to pay enough to keep the truck rolling toward the next paid leg.

Third piece: a Friday call for the following week. The operator spends 20 to 40 minutes Friday afternoon working the broker network for what’s available the following week on the primary lane. By Friday night, two of the next week’s loads are booked. The other two slots are flexible, but the spine is in place before the weekend starts. Operators who don’t do this start every Monday in reactive mode and never quite catch up.

Fourth piece: a weekly debrief on what worked. Five minutes on Sunday. Which loads paid. Which lanes had reload. Which broker called back. Which one didn’t. Over a quarter, this debrief is what tells the operator which two or three broker dispatchers are actually worth the relationship and which ones are eating time without producing freight.

The 40 percent number broken down

An operator running 2,500 total miles a week at 18 percent deadhead is running 2,050 loaded miles. At 8 percent deadhead, the same total mileage is 2,300 loaded miles. The difference is 250 miles a week, or 13,000 miles a year.

At a $2.10 average loaded rate, that’s $525 a week, or $27,300 a year, without changing fuel cost (deadhead miles still cost fuel) and without changing hours behind the wheel. The truck just runs paid miles instead of repositioning.

Metric Daily reactive Weekly planned
Total miles per week 2,500 2,500
Deadhead % 18% 8%
Loaded miles 2,050 2,300
Hours between loads 14-18 2-6
Average rate per loaded mile $2.05 $2.20
Weekly gross $4,200 $5,060
Annual difference ~$45,000

The rate per loaded mile also climbs in the planned version, because the operator is no longer taking whatever the load board has at the destination. The combination of fewer dead miles and a higher average rate is where the larger annual delta comes from. The “40 percent deadhead reduction” headline is real. The dollar number underneath it is bigger than the percentage suggests.

How to actually do it

The hardest part of weekly planning is the first two weeks. The operator has to commit to a primary lane before the truck has a track record on it. The brokers won’t have a feel for the truck yet. The reload calls feel premature. The debrief feels like overkill on five loads.

By week three, the pattern starts producing. The same dispatcher calls back on the primary lane. The reload at the destination is already in someone’s head before the operator lands. The Friday call is shorter because three of the lanes already have something queued.

By week six, the operator is running with 8 to 12 percent deadhead instead of 18 percent, and most of the change came from doing the same work in a different order. Not from working harder. Not from finding a magic load board. From booking the next leg before the current leg delivered.

Common failures

Operators who try to plan weekly and abandon it usually quit for one of three reasons.

Over-committing to the lane. The lane stops producing for one week and the operator reads it as a system failure. Lanes have noise. The fix is the backup lanes, not abandoning the spine.

Booking too rigidly. The operator commits to four loads on Monday and discovers Tuesday that one of them doesn’t fit. The fix is two booked loads and two flexible slots, not four committed.

Skipping the Friday call. The week starts Monday in reactive mode, and the planning system never gets the chance to compound. By Wednesday the operator is back on the load board between loads and the deadhead climbs.

The honest version

Cutting deadhead is not about driving harder or finding better loads. It’s about booking in a different order, on a different time horizon, with a different set of relationships.

The operators running at 8 to 10 percent deadhead built that number over six to twelve weeks of disciplined weekly planning. The operators stuck at 18 to 22 percent are running the same lanes with the same brokers in a daily reactive loop. The freight isn’t the difference. The order is.
